Transaction 313ade520612f91b0b19f70142a9011b9f28f81b1b2ecc9ec53c72c10ca9c81a
1 Input
1 Output
-
313ade520612f91b0b19f70142a9011b9f28f81b1b2ecc9ec53c72c10ca9c81a:0
- value
- 2143720
- script pubkey
- OP_0 OP_PUSHBYTES_20 4a5db85d9ddf068f0880be632c0dc2874dc8c8c3
- address
- bc1qffwmshvamurg7zyqhe3jcrwzsaxu3jxrvl0eq8